Steering clear of relationships has never been difficult for demolitions expert Cole Bowen, but now, with his brother's engagement sending the female population into full-blown hysterics and the town of Alden's month-long festivities helping along, he finds himself in hell. When he discovers Alden's new resident and the object of all his wet dreams, Christine Sheridan, has sworn off relationships and is going to hire a gigolo to get professionally laid, he decides to kill two birds with one stone.

Christy is so not drinking again. Thanks to José Cuervo she has her friends signing her up for stud conventions and Cole frigging Bowen offering sex in exchange of fake dates, which is so out of the question it isn't even funny. She knows the domineering man will push her boundaries, and after battling all her life with self-esteem issues, she isn't ready for that. Too bad he won't take no for an answer.

Cole is determined to strip away all of her defenses but refuses to lower his ever-present walls, so when Christy realizes she wants more, she's left with only two options; walk away or crack his shield and risk her heart in the process.

After one emotionally intense read, I was in dire need of a feel-good story --- and this one felt like an answered prayer.

After a long engagement gone bad -- Christy realized that she needed to dust the cobwebs off her vagina -- no-strings-attached style! And what's the most convenient way to do it? Hire a first-class stud of course! Pronto! Or is it just the tequila talking?

Enter Cole -- a rich demolitions expert AND one of the infamous Bowen brothers -- who made it pretty clear that he wasn't into relationships; but decided that Christy was hot enough for him to consider being her man-whore.

His brilliant idea? Christy gets her no-strings-attached sex, and he'll have his decoy date for the festivities. Whoa. Perfect economical exchange!

But then who could resist an alpha male like Cole who keeps on pushing himself to Christy's life?

So there goes the story of Cole and Christy -- even with all the baggages between the two, the book spells FUN and STEAMY. Just the way I like it.

Well, Cole is definitely book boyfriend material. I liked his guts. I mean, who wouldn't? He's a hard, arrogant and sexy man, and he knows it. He talks smack that could make any decent girl blush and clearly runs the show here. It's not everyday you encounter this kind of guy. And If I ever meet one in real life, I would definitely act like Christy and won't ever give him the time of day. He's a walking heartbreak.
